Subject: [PATCH v2 3/3] perf vendor events: Update metric events for power10 platform
Date: Tue, 5 Sep 2023 17:10:39 +0530 [thread overview]
Message-ID: <20230905114039.176645-3-kjain@linux.ibm.com> (raw)
In-Reply-To: <20230905114039.176645-1-kjain@linux.ibm.com>
Update JSON/events for power10 platform with additional metrics.
Signed-off-by: Kajol Jain <kjain@linux.ibm.com>
---
.../arch/powerpc/power10/metrics.json | 388 ++++++++++++++++++
1 file changed, 388 insertions(+)
diff --git a/tools/perf/pmu-events/arch/powerpc/power10/metrics.json b/tools/perf/pmu-events/arch/powerpc/power10/metrics.json
index 4d66b75c6ad5..a36621858ea3 100644
--- a/tools/perf/pmu-events/arch/powerpc/power10/metrics.json
+++ b/tools/perf/pmu-events/arch/powerpc/power10/metrics.json
@@ -434,6 +434,13 @@
"MetricName": "L1_INST_MISS_RATE",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of completed instructions that were demand fetches that missed the L1 and L2 instruction cache",
+ "MetricExpr": "PM_INST_FROM_L2MISS *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"General",
+ "MetricName": "L2_INST_MISS_RATE",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of completed instructions that were demand fetches that reloaded from beyond the L3 icache",
"MetricExpr": "PM_INST_FROM_L3MISS / PM_RUN_INST_CMPL * 100",
@@ -466,6 +473,13 @@
"MetricGroup": "General",
"MetricName": "LOADS_PER_INST"
},
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ded from the L2 per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_L2 *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L2_RATE",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of demand loads that reloaded from beyond the L2 per completed instruction",
"MetricExpr": "PM_DATA_FROM_L2MISS / PM_RUN_INST_CMPL * 100",
@@ -473,6 +487,34 @@
"MetricName": "DL1_RELOAD_FROM_L2_MISS_RATE",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ded using modified data from another core's L2 or L3 on a remote chip, per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_RL2L3_MOD *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RL2L3_MOD_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ded using shared data from another core's L2 or L3 on a remote chip, per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_RL2L3_SHR *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RL2L3_SHR_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ded from the L3 per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_L3 *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L3_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ded with data brought into the L3 by prefetch per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_L3_MEPF *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L3_MEPF_RATE",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of demand loads that reloaded from beyond the L3 per completed instruction",
"MetricExpr": "PM_DATA_FROM_L3MISS / PM_RUN_INST_CMPL * 100",
@@ -480,6 +522,66 @@
"MetricName": "DL1_RELOAD_FROM_L3_MISS_RATE",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ded using modified data from another core's L2 or L3 on a distant chip, per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_DL2L3_MOD *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DL2L3_MOD_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ded using shared data from another core's L2 or L3 on a distant chip, per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_DL2L3_SHR *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DL2L3_SHR_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ded from local memory per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_LMEM *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_LMEM_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ded from remote memory per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_RMEM *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RMEM_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and loads that reloaded from distant memory per completed instruction",
+ "MetricExpr": "PM_DATA_FROM_DMEM *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DMEM_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of data reloads from local memory per data reloads from any memory",
+ "MetricExpr": "PM_DATA_FROM_LMEM * 100 / (PM_DATA_FROM_LMEM + PM_DATA_FROM_RMEM + PM_DATA_FROM_DMEM)",
+ "MetricGroup": "Memory",
+ "MetricName": "MEM_LOCALITY",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Number of data reloads from local memory per data reloads from remote memory",
+ "MetricExpr": "PM_DATA_FROM_LMEM / PM_DATA_FROM_RMEM",
+ "MetricGroup": "Memory",
+ "MetricName": "LD_LMEM_PER_LD_RMEM"
+ },
+ {
+ "BriefDescription": "Number of data reloads from local memory per data reloads from distant memory",
+ "MetricExpr": "PM_DATA_FROM_LMEM / PM_DATA_FROM_DMEM",
+ "MetricGroup": "Memory",
+ "MetricName": "LD_LMEM_PER_LD_DMEM"
+ },
+ {
+ "BriefDescription": "Number of data reloads from local memory per data reloads from distant and remote memory",
+ "MetricExpr": "PM_DATA_FROM_LMEM / (PM_DATA_FROM_DMEM + PM_DATA_FROM_RMEM)",
+ "MetricGroup": "Memory",
+ "MetricName": "LD_LMEM_PER_LD_MEM"
+ },
{
"BriefDescription": "Percentage of ITLB misses per completed run instruction",
"MetricExpr": "PM_ITLB_MISS / PM_RUN_INST_CMPL * 100",
@@ -487,6 +589,12 @@
"MetricName": "ITLB_MISS_RATE",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Number of data reloads from remote memory per data reloads from distant memory",
+ "MetricExpr": "PM_DATA_FROM_RMEM / PM_DATA_FROM_DMEM",
+ "MetricGroup": "Memory",
+ "MetricName": "LD_RMEM_PER_LD_DMEM"
+ },
{
"BriefDescription": "Percentage of DERAT misses with 4k page size per completed instruction",
"MetricExpr": "PM_DERAT_MISS_4K / PM_RUN_INST_CMPL * 100",
@@ -501,6 +609,76 @@
"MetricName": "DERAT_64K_MISS_RATE",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of ICache misses that were reloaded from the L2",
+ "MetricExpr": "PM_INST_FROM_L2 * 100 / PM_L1_ICACHE_MISS",
+ "MetricGroup": "Instruction_Stats",
+ "MetricName": "INST_FROM_L2",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ache misses that were reloaded from the L3",
+ "MetricExpr": "PM_INST_FROM_L3 * 100 / PM_L1_ICACHE_MISS",
+ "MetricGroup": "Instruction_Stats",
+ "MetricName": "INST_FROM_L3",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ache misses that were reloaded from local memory",
+ "MetricExpr": "PM_INST_FROM_LMEM * 100 / PM_L1_ICACHE_MISS",
+ "MetricGroup": "Instruction_Stats",
+ "MetricName": "INST_FROM_LME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ache misses that were reloaded from remote memory",
+ "MetricExpr": "PM_INST_FROM_RMEM * 100 / PM_L1_ICACHE_MISS",
+ "MetricGroup": "Instruction_Stats",
+ "MetricName": "INST_FROM_RME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ache misses that were reloaded from distant memory",
+ "MetricExpr": "PM_INST_FROM_DMEM * 100 / PM_L1_ICACHE_MISS",
+ "MetricGroup": "Instruction_Stats",
+ "MetricName": "INST_FROM_DME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ache reloads from the L2 per completed instruction",
+ "MetricExpr": "PM_INST_FROM_L2 *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_L2_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ache reloads from the L3 per completed instruction",
+ "MetricExpr": "PM_INST_FROM_L3 *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_L3_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ache reloads from local memory per completed instruction",
+ "MetricExpr": "PM_INST_FROM_LMEM *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_LMEM_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ache reloads from remote memory per completed instruction",
+ "MetricExpr": "PM_INST_FROM_RMEM *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_RMEM_RATE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of ICache reloads from distant memory per completed instruction",
+ "MetricExpr": "PM_INST_FROM_DMEM *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_DMEM_RATE",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Average number of run cycles per completed instruction",
"MetricExpr": "PM_RUN_CYC / PM_RUN_INST_CMPL",
@@ -607,6 +785,13 @@
"MetricName": "DL1_MISS_RELOADS",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from the local L2",
+ "MetricExpr": "PM_DATA_FROM_L2 *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L2",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of demand load misses that reloaded from beyond the local L2",
"MetricExpr": "PM_DATA_FROM_L2MISS / PM_LD_DEMAND_MISS_L1 * 100",
@@ -614,6 +799,13 @@
"MetricName": "DL1_RELOAD_FROM_L2_MISS",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from the local L3",
+ "MetricExpr": "PM_DATA_FROM_L3 *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L3",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of demand load misses that reloaded from beyond the local L3",
"MetricExpr": "PM_DATA_FROM_L3MISS / PM_LD_DEMAND_MISS_L1 * 100",
@@ -621,6 +813,188 @@
"MetricName": "DL1_RELOAD_FROM_L3_MISS",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from the local L3 with modified data",
+ "MetricExpr": "PM_DATA_FROM_L3_MEPF *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L3_MEPF",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on the same regent with modified data",
+ "MetricExpr": "PM_DATA_FROM_L21_REGENT_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L21_REGENT_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on the same regent with shared data",
+ "MetricExpr": "PM_DATA_FROM_L21_REGENT_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L21_REGENT_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on the same chip in a different regent with modified data",
+ "MetricExpr": "PM_DATA_FROM_L21_NON_REGENT_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L21_NON_REGENT_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on the same chip in a different regent with shared data",
+ "MetricExpr": "PM_DATA_FROM_L21_NON_REGENT_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L21_NON_REGENT_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on the same regent with modified data",
+ "MetricExpr": "PM_DATA_FROM_L31_REGENT_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L31_REGENT_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on the same regent with shared data",
+ "MetricExpr": "PM_DATA_FROM_L31_REGENT_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L31_REGENT_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on the same chip in a different regent with modified data",
+ "MetricExpr": "PM_DATA_FROM_L31_NON_REGENT_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L31_NON_REGENT_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on the same chip in a different regent with shared data",
+ "MetricExpr": "PM_DATA_FROM_L31_NON_REGENT_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L31_NON_REGENT_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on a remote chip with modified data",
+ "MetricExpr": "PM_DATA_FROM_RL2_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RL2_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on a remote chip with shared data",
+ "MetricExpr": "PM_DATA_FROM_RL2_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RL2_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on a remote chip with modified data",
+ "MetricExpr": "PM_DATA_FROM_RL3_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RL3_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on a remote chip with shared data",
+ "MetricExpr": "PM_DATA_FROM_RL3_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RL3_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on a distant chip with modified data",
+ "MetricExpr": "PM_DATA_FROM_DL2_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DL2_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L2 on a distant chip with shared data",
+ "MetricExpr": "PM_DATA_FROM_DL2_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DL2_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on a distant chip with modified data",
+ "MetricExpr": "PM_DATA_FROM_DL3_MOD *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DL3_MOD",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from another core's L3 on a distant chip with shared data",
+ "MetricExpr": "PM_DATA_FROM_DL3_SHR *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DL3_SHR",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from the local chip's memory",
+ "MetricExpr": "PM_DATA_FROM_LMEM *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_LME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from the local chip's OpenCAPI Cache",
+ "MetricExpr": "PM_DATA_FROM_L_OC_CACHE *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L_OC_CACHE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from the local chip's OpenCAPI memory",
+ "MetricExpr": "PM_DATA_FROM_L_OC_MEM *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_L_OC_ME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from a remote chip's memory",
+ "MetricExpr": "PM_DATA_FROM_RMEM *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_RME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from a remote chip's OpenCAPI Cache",
+ "MetricExpr": "PM_DATA_FROM_R_OC_CACHE *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_R_OC_CACHE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from a remote chip's OpenCAPI memory",
+ "MetricExpr": "PM_DATA_FROM_R_OC_MEM *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_R_OC_ME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from a distant chip's memory",
+ "MetricExpr": "PM_DATA_FROM_DMEM *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_DMEM",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from a distant chip's OpenCAPI Cache",
+ "MetricExpr": "PM_DATA_FROM_D_OC_CACHE *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_D_OC_CACHE",
+ "ScaleUnit": "1%"
+ },
+ {
+ "BriefDescription": "Percentage of demand load misses that reloaded from a distant chip's OpenCAPI memory",
+ "MetricExpr": "PM_DATA_FROM_D_OC_MEM * 100 / PM_LD_DEMAND_MISS_L1",
+ "MetricGroup": "dL1_Reloads",
+ "MetricName": "DL1_RELOAD_FROM_D_OC_MEM",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of cycles stalled due to the NTC instruction waiting for a load miss to resolve from a source beyond the local L2 and local L3",
"MetricExpr": "DMISS_L3MISS_STALL_CPI / RUN_CPI * 100",
@@ -686,6 +1060,13 @@
"MetricName": "DERAT_MISS_RELOAD",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of ICache misses that were reloaded from beyond the local L2",
+ "MetricExpr": "PM_INST_FROM_L2MISS * 100 / PM_L1_ICACHE_MISS",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_L2_MISS",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of icache misses that were reloaded from beyond the local L3",
"MetricExpr": "PM_INST_FROM_L3MISS / PM_L1_ICACHE_MISS * 100",
@@ -693,6 +1074,13 @@
"MetricName": "INST_FROM_L3_MISS",
"ScaleUnit": "1%"
},
+ {
+ "BriefDescription": "Percentage of ICache reloads from beyond the L2 per completed instruction",
+ "MetricExpr": "PM_INST_FROM_L2MISS * 100 / PM_RUN_INST_CMPL",
+ "MetricGroup": "Instruction_Misses",
+ "MetricName": "INST_FROM_L2_MISS_RATE",
+ "ScaleUnit": "1%"
+ },
{
"BriefDescription": "Percentage of icache reloads from the beyond the L3 per completed instruction",
"MetricExpr": "PM_INST_FROM_L3MISS / PM_RUN_INST_CMPL * 100",
